The term balance sheet refers to financial statements that show the assets, liabilities and equity of a company at a given time. Balance sheets form the basis for calculating returns for investors and assessing a company`s capital structure. In short, the balance sheet is a financial statement that provides an overview of what a company owns and owes, as well as the amount invested by shareholders.
Balance sheets can be used with other significant financial statements to perform fundamental analysis or calculate financial measures. This is a snapshot at some point of the company`s financial statements, which cover its assets, liabilities and equity. There are two types of assets: current assets and non-current assets. Non-current assets refer to assets that cannot be liquidated within one year. These assets have a longer lifespan than working capital. They refer to tangible assets such as machinery, computers, the building in which your company operates and the country. Non-current assets can also be intangible assets such as patents, goodwill and copyrights. These assets are not physical in nature, but they can determine whether a market does so or not. The “Assets” section of the balance sheet breaks down the value of your business that can be converted into cash.
Your balance sheet lists your assets in order of liquidity; That is, it declares assets in the order of how easily they can be converted into cash. By comparing your company`s current assets with its current liabilities, you get a clear picture of your company`s liquidity. In other words, it shows you how much money you have at your disposal.
It is advisable to have a buffer between your current assets and liabilities to cover your short-term financial obligations. Your assets should be larger than the liabilities.
